body
{
    BACKGROUND-COLOR: white;
    margin:0px;
}
h1{ font-size:16px; color:#050071}
input { font-family:Tahoma; font-size:11px;}
textarea{ font-family:Tahoma; font-size:11px; }
select { font-family:Tahoma; font-size:11px; }
td { font-family:Tahoma; font-size:11px; color:#808080}
.blacktext{ color:#000000}
.greytext{ color:#808080}
.greentext{ color:#7DBC00}
.whitetext{ color:#ffffff}
.redtext{color:#E70000}
.orange{ background-color:#FF6600;color:#ffffff}
.orangebox{ border:solid 1px #FF6600}
.catno{ color:#E70000; font-weight:bolder; font-size:13px;}
input.40pixels{ width:40px}
li{list-style-type: disc;  }
ul{ padding-left:0px; text-indent:0px; margin-left:16px; margin-bottom:0px; margin-top:10px;}

a.nav:link {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}
a.nav:visited {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}
a.nav:hover { font-size:11px; color:#00247E; text-decoration:none; font-family:Tahoma;}

a.greennav:link { font-size:11px; color:#7DBC00; text-decoration:none; font-family:Tahoma;}
a.greennav:visited { font-size:11px; color:#7DBC00; text-decoration:none; font-family:Tahoma;}
a.greennav:hover { font-size:11px; color:#7DBC00; text-decoration:none; font-family:Tahoma;}


a.whitenav:link {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}
a.whitenav:visited {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}
a.whitenav:hover {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}

a.blacknav:link { font-size:11px; color:#000000; text-decoration:none; font-family:Tahoma;}
a.blacknav:visited { font-size:11px; color:#000000; text-decoration:none; font-family:Tahoma;}
a.blacknav:hover { font-size:11px; color:#000000; text-decoration:underline; font-family:Tahoma;}

a.greynav:link { font-size:11px; color:#808080; text-decoration:none; font-family:Tahoma;}
a.greynav:visited { font-size:11px; color:#808080; text-decoration:none; font-family:Tahoma;}
a.greynav:hover { font-size:11px; color:#808080; text-decoration:underline; font-family:Tahoma;}


a.plainblacknav:link { font-size:11px; color:#003F8F; text-decoration:none; font-family:Tahoma;}
a.plainblacknav:visited { font-size:11px; color:#003F8F; text-decoration:none; font-family:Tahoma;}
a.plainblacknav:hover { font-size:11px; color:#003F8F; text-decoration:none; font-family:Tahoma;}

a.productnav:link { font-size:11px; color:#345384; text-decoration:none; font-family:Tahoma;}
a.productnav:visited { font-size:11px; color:#345384; text-decoration:none; font-family:Tahoma;}
a.productnav:hover { font-size:11px; color:#345384; text-decoration:underline; font-family:Tahoma;}

.darkblue{ color:#345384;}

a:link { font-size:11px; color:#1300FE; text-decoration:underline; font-family:Tahoma;}
a:visited { font-size:11px; color:#1300FE; text-decoration:underline; font-family:Tahoma;}
a:hover { font-size:11px; color:#1300FE; text-decoration:underline; font-family:Tahoma;}

a.breadcrumb:link { font-size:11px; color:#808080; text-decoration:none; font-family:Tahoma;}
a.breadcrumb:visited { font-size:11px; color:#808080; text-decoration:none; font-family:Tahoma;}
a.breadcrumb:hover { font-size:11px; color:#808080; text-decoration:none; font-family:Tahoma;}

a.whitelink:link { font-size:11px; color:#ffffff; text-decoration:none; font-weight:bold; font-family:Tahoma;}
a.whitelink:visited { font-size:11px; color:#ffffff; text-decoration:none; font-weight:bold;font-family:Tahoma;}
a.whitelink:hover { font-size:11px; color:#ffffff; text-decoration:underline; font-weight:bold;font-family:Tahoma;}

a.greylink:link { font-size:11px; color:#B5B5B5; text-decoration:none;  font-family:Tahoma;}
a.greylink:visited { font-size:11px; color:#B5B5B5; text-decoration:none; font-family:Tahoma;}
a.greylink:hover { font-size:11px; color:#B5B5B5; text-decoration:underline; font-family:Tahoma;}

a.smallwhitelink:link {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}
a.smallwhitelink:visited {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}
a.smallwhitelink:hover { font-size:11px; color:#ffffff; text-decoration:underline; font-family:Tahoma;}

a.silverlink:link { font-size:11px; color:#cccccc; text-decoration:none; font-weight:bold; font-family:Tahoma;}
a.silverlink:visited { font-size:11px; color:#cccccc; text-decoration:none; font-weight:bold;font-family:Tahoma;}
a.silverlink:hover { font-size:11px; color:#cccccc; text-decoration:underline; font-weight:bold;font-family:Tahoma;}

a.largegrey:link { font-size:12px; color:#999999; text-decoration:none; font-weight:bold; font-family:Tahoma;}
a.largegrey:visited { font-size:12px; color:#999999; text-decoration:none; font-weight:bold;font-family:Tahoma;}
a.largegrey:hover { font-size:12px; color:#999999; text-decoration:underline; font-weight:bold;font-family:Tahoma;}

a.scrollerlink:link { font-size:15px; color:#000000; text-decoration:none; font-weight:bold; font-family:Tahoma;}
a.scrollerlink:visited { font-size:15px; color:#000000; text-decoration:none; font-weight:bold;font-family:Tahoma;}
a.scrollerlink:hover { font-size:15px; color:#000000; text-decoration:underline; font-weight:bold;font-family:Tahoma;}

a.navlink:link { font-size:11px; color:#043E8F; text-decoration:none; font-family:Tahoma; font-weight:bold}
a.navlink:visited { font-size:11px; color:#043E8F; text-decoration:none; font-family:Tahoma; font-weight:bold}
a.navlink:hover { font-size:11px; color:#043E8F; text-decoration:underline; font-family:Tahoma; font-weight:bold}

a.leftnav:link {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}
a.leftnav:visited { font-size:11px; color:#ffffff; text-decoration:none; font-family:Tahoma;}
a.leftnav:hover { font-size:11px; color:#ffffff; text-decoration:underline; font-family:Tahoma;}

a.offersdescrition:link { color:#DB003E; text-decoration:none; }
a.offersdescrition:visited { color:#DB003E; text-decoration:none; }
a.offersdescrition:hover { color:#DB003E; text-decoration:underline; }

.navcolor { background:#63A9CD}
.title			{ font-family:Tahoma; font-size:17px; color:#7DBC00}
.hometitle		{ font-family:Tahoma; font-size:15px; color:#63A9CD; font-weight:bold }
.subtitle	{font-family:Tahoma; font-size:14px; color:#000000;}
.button { border:solid 1px #98989A; font-size:11px; background-color:#ffffff; color:#000000;cursor:hand; height:18px; text-decoration:none  }
.leftborder{ border-left:solid 1px #98989A;}
.rightborder{ border-right:solid 1px #98989A;}
.topborder{ border-left:solid 1px #98989A;}
.bottomborder{ border-left:solid 1px #98989A;}
.line	{ background-color:#98989A;}
.liteline { background-color: #CCD1D4;}
.head { font-size:11px; color:#ffffff; font-family:Tahoma; font-weight:bold; background-color:#10147f}
.scrollertext { font-size:15px; font-weight:bold; font-family:Tahoma}
.productbox	{border:solid 1px #0B0B6D; background-color:#ffffff; }
.offersbox	{border:solid 1px #C8C9DB; background-color:#ffffff; }
.borderline	{border:solid 1px #C8C9DB; }
.offerstitle	{ color:#291F5B;}
.mfr	{ color:#296357;}
.description	{ color:#DB003E;}
.price	{ color:#FF6F1D;}
.offersborder	{ border-right:solid 1px #C8C9DB;}

.litegrey{ background-color:#ECECEC; color:Black; font-size:11px}
.box { border:solid 1px #bdbebd}
.options { color:#82A1CF; font-size:11px}

.greytab{ background-color:#B4B4B4; vertical-align:top}
.dark { background-color:#003F8F; color:#ffffff; font-weight:bold;}
.mid { background-color:#D3E5FD; color:#000000 }
.light { background-color:#ECECEC;}
.tb{ width:200px}
.basket{ background-color:#FFFFB0; border:solid 1px #10147f}
.bluebox{ border:solid 1px #10147f}
.grad { 
filter: progid:DXImageTransform.Microsoft.Gradient(gradientType=0,startColorStr=#ffffff,endColorStr=#cccccc);  
} 

div.roundcorner2 {
	   background: url(indeximages/right_corner.gif) no-repeat top right;
	   width:100%;
	   height:100%;
	   text-align:center;
	}
div.roundcorner2 div {
	background: url(indeximages/left_corner.gif) no-repeat top left;
	width:100%;
	   height:100%;
	   text-align:center;
	   
}

div.roundcorner2a {
	   background: url(indeximages/right_corner.gif) no-repeat top right;
	   width:100%;
	   height:100%;
	   text-align:center;
	}
div.roundcorner2a div {
	background: url(indeximages/left_corner_2a.gif) no-repeat top left;
	width:100%;
	   height:100%;
	   text-align:center;
	   
}

div.roundcorner3 {
	   background: url(indeximages/right_curve.gif) no-repeat top right;
	   width:100%;
	   height:100%;
	}


div.roundcorner3a {
	   background: url(indeximages/right_corner2a.gif) no-repeat top right;
	   width:100%;
	   height:100%;
	   text-align:center;
	}
div.roundcorner3a div {
	background: url(indeximages/left_corner.gif) no-repeat top left;
	width:100%;
	   height:100%;
	   text-align:center;
	   
}



